揭秘社交平台源码:如何从零开始打造自己的社交帝国
随着互联网的飞速发展,社交平台已经成为人们日常生活中不可或缺的一部分。从微信、微博到抖音、快手,各种社交平台层出不穷,吸引了无数用户的关注。然而,你是否想过,这些社交平台的源码是如何编写出来的?今天,就让我们一起来揭秘社交平台源码的秘密,了解如何从零开始打造自己的社交帝国。
一、社交平台源码概述
社交平台源码,顾名思义,就是指社交平台的代码。它包含了网站的前端代码、后端代码、数据库设计、服务器配置等各个方面。一个完整的社交平台源码,需要涵盖用户注册、登录、发布动态、评论、私信、朋友圈等功能。
二、社交平台源码的编写步骤
1.需求分析
在编写社交平台源码之前,首先要明确平台的功能和定位。例如,是面向年轻人的社交平台,还是面向企业用户的商务社交平台。明确需求后,才能有针对性地进行开发。
2.技术选型
社交平台源码的编写,需要选择合适的技术栈。以下是一些常用的技术:
(1)前端:HTML、CSS、JavaScript(Vue.js、React、Angular等)
(2)后端:Java、Python、PHP、Node.js等
(3)数据库:MySQL、MongoDB、Redis等
(4)服务器:Linux、Windows等
3.数据库设计
数据库是社交平台的核心,需要设计合理的表结构,包括用户表、动态表、评论表、私信表等。同时,要考虑数据的安全性和性能。
4.编写前端代码
前端代码主要负责展示界面和与用户交互。使用HTML、CSS、JavaScript等技术,编写页面布局、样式和交互逻辑。
5.编写后端代码
后端代码主要负责处理业务逻辑、数据存储和接口调用。使用Java、Python、PHP、Node.js等技术,编写服务器端代码。
6.集成与测试
将前端和后端代码集成在一起,进行功能测试、性能测试和安全性测试。确保平台稳定、安全、高效。
7.部署上线
选择合适的服务器,将平台部署上线。进行域名解析、SSL证书配置等操作,确保平台能够被用户访问。
三、社交平台源码的优势
1.降低开发成本
使用社交平台源码,可以避免从头开始编写代码,节省开发时间和人力成本。
2.提高开发效率
社交平台源码已经具备了一定的功能,开发者可以根据实际需求进行修改和扩展,提高开发效率。
3.保障平台质量
社交平台源码经过多次测试和优化,具有较高的稳定性和可靠性。
4.降低运营成本
使用社交平台源码,可以降低平台运营成本,提高盈利能力。
四、总结
社交平台源码是构建社交帝国的重要基石。通过了解社交平台源码的编写步骤和优势,我们可以更好地把握社交平台的发展趋势,打造属于自己的社交帝国。当然,在开发过程中,要注重用户体验,不断创新,才能在激烈的市场竞争中脱颖而出。